    1. Freelancing: Turn Skills into Cash

    The freelance market offers an excellent opportunity to monetize your skills, whether you’re a writer, designer, or developer. Platforms like Upwork or Fiverr enable you to connect with clients worldwide and take on projects that fit your expertise. To succeed, tailor your profile to showcase your best work and attract clients who can benefit from your unique talents.

    Practical actions to get started include creating a compelling profile that highlights your skills and previous work experiences. Aim for certifications or small projects to build your portfolio, which will increase your chances of securing larger contracts. For instance, if you’re a graphic designer, showcase your best works, even personal projects, to demonstrate your capabilities to potential clients.

    2. Affiliate Marketing: Earn While You Share

    This income stream allows you to earn commission by promoting products or services. By sharing unique links through blogs, social media, or email newsletters, you can tap into a revenue source that grows as you build an audience. Start by choosing a niche and sign up for affiliate programs relevant to your interests.

    To maximize your success, focus on creating valuable content that resonates with your audience. For instance, if you’re passionate about fitness, you could review equipment or share workout routines linked to affiliate products. This not only drives traffic to your content but can also lead to higher conversion rates as readers trust your recommendations.

    3. Print on Demand: Monetize Your Designs

    If you have a knack for design, consider venturing into the print-on-demand industry. This model allows you to create and sell custom products—think t-shirts, mugs, or posters—without holding any inventory. Platforms like Printful or Redbubble handle production and shipping, allowing you to focus on designing.

    Begin by determining your niche and target audience. Once established, utilize social media to showcase your designs. Engage with your followers to cultivate a loyal customer base while leveraging user-generated content to enhance your brand’s visibility.     8. Digital Products: Create and Sell

    Digital products, such as eBooks, templates, or stock photos, allow you to earn money without the overhead of physical goods. By creating quality digital products tailored to your audience’s needs, you can automate sales through your website or platforms like Gumroad.

    Research what products are trending in your niche and create high-quality, usable resources. For example, if you’re in the finance niche, consider a budgeting template or an investment guide eBook. Once launched, promote your digital products through social media and your email list to drive traffic and sales.

    10. Stock Photography: Capture and Sell Your Passion

    If you enjoy photography, consider turning your work into a source of income by selling stock photos. Platforms such as Shutterstock or Adobe Stock allow photographers to upload their images for royalties each time a photo is downloaded. To thrive, focus on creating high-quality images that cater to popular categories.

    Understanding Passive Income

    Passive income is money earned with little to no effort on the part of the recipient to maintain it. Unlike active income, where you earn a paycheck for your time and effort, passive income streams can provide financial rewards over time. However, it’s important to note that while you won’t need to work constantly, building these streams often requires substantial initial work or investment.

    Top Passive Income Ideas

    • Affiliate Marketing
    • Affiliate marketing allows you to earn a commission by promoting other people’s products. You can do this through a blog, YouTube channel, or social media platforms. Start by choosing a niche that interests you, finding affiliate programs related to that niche, and creating content that brings in traffic. The more value your content provides, the more likely you are to generate income.

    • Investing in Dividend Stocks
    • Investing in dividend-paying stocks can provide a steady stream of income. Unlike regular stocks, which you rely on to appreciate, dividend stocks pay you just for holding them. Research and select companies with a history of steady dividends and be ready to commit for the long term. Be sure to diversify your investments to minimize risk.

    • Real Estate Crowdfunding
    • If traditional real estate investment seems out of reach, consider real estate crowdfunding. Platforms allow individuals to pool their money to invest in larger properties. This approach enables you to earn returns from real estate without the hassles of managing properties. However, perform thorough due diligence on the crowdfunding platform and projects.

    • Create an Online Course
    • If you have expertise in a specific field, creating an online course could be a lucrative passive income stream. Platforms like Udemy or Teachable let you reach a global audience. Invest time in developing quality content and marketing your course; once established, it can continue to generate income with minimal updates.

    1. Rental Income Through Real Estate Investment

    • Real Estate Crowdfunding: If owning property seems daunting, consider participating in real estate crowdfunding. Companies such as Fundrise or RealtyMogul allow you to invest in larger projects for a smaller amount of money.
    • Short-term Rentals: Platforms like Airbnb let you rent out your space. This option works best if you have a spare room or property in a desirable location.

    2. Investing in Dividend Stocks

    Investing in dividend stocks is a fantastic approach for beginners. Many companies reward their shareholders with dividends, which can be reinvested or taken as cash. Here’s a quick start guide:

    • Research companies with a solid history of dividend payments.
    • Diversify your portfolio to minimize risks.
    • Consider using a Dividend Reinvestment Plan (DRIP) to maximize wealth accumulation.

    3. Peer-to-Peer Lending

    Peer-to-peer (P2P) lending platforms, such as Prosper or LendingClub, allow individuals to lend to others while earning interest on the loans. While lending does carry some risk, it can be a lucrative source of passive income:

    • Make sure to thoroughly evaluate borrower profiles before lending.
    • Consider diversifying your loans across multiple borrowers to spread your risk.

    5. Investing in Index Funds

    Index funds are a great avenue for beginners. They allow you to invest in a collection of stocks or bonds, thereby minimizing individual stock risk:

    • Choose funds that track major indices like the S&P 500.
    • Regularly contribute to your investment to take advantage of dollar-cost averaging.
